General Info
Age Groups: 5 year increments from 15 up to oldest competitor: 15-19, 20-24, 25-29, 30-34, 35-39, 40-44, 45-49, 50-54, 55-59, 60-64 , etc.
Age according to USAT rules: corresponding to the athlete’s age on December 31 of the year of the event
Triathlon Awards will be given to TOP THREE men and women in EACH category and overall top male and female.
Duathlon Awards, due to a smaller number of entrants, will be awarded in 10 year increments up to the oldest competitor: 15-19, 20-29, 30-39, 40-49, 50-59, 60-69 etc.....the top finisher ineach age category and to the overall top male and female.

Race will proceed rain or shine. Race Director reserves the right to cancel or change event if weather conditions warrant.
FOR SAFETY REASONS: PLEASE, NO ANIMALS ALLOWED AT THE RACE SITE. NO HEADPHONES OR JOG STROLLERS PERMITTED ON THE COURSE.
No drafting is allowed. We will have course marshalls and possibly USAT race officials on site enforcing rules.
Helmets are mandatory on bike sections and must be on and chin strap fastened before you mount your bike and remain on until after you dismount.
You must wear your helmet/bike number on the bike leg and your running number on the run leg.
DO NOT tear off the tag on your running number unless instructed to do so at the finsh line.
Please arrive early Sunday morning. You will need to pick up your timing chip and get your body marked.
If you are local, I strongly suggest picking up your race packet on Saturday as things get busy on race morning.
You must wear the swim cap that is provided to you and swim with your designated wave.
No outside assistance is allowed in the transition or on the course. we will have a vehicle patroling for pick-up assistance in the event of a bike failure.
No abuse of volunteers, police or others will be tolerated. Any abuse will lead to disqualification.
Please do not discard your GU packets, wrappers, water bottles or similar products on the course. Help us be good neighbors with the City of Harrisburg.
Awards must be picked up at the race. We will do our best to start awards no later than 10.00am and keep it brief.
We will have a local bike shop on site to provide some basic bike repair assistance if needed, but please inspect your bike prior to the race.
Open Water Swim Notes and Cautions
This is an open water swim. There are no lines for guidance or walls to rest on. The river is relatively safe and shallow enough to stand in most places but it is a dynamic and changing body of water that should be respected. We will have Harrisburg river rescue and certified life guards on site.
We will be testing the water in advance of the race for your safety.
Water temperature is usually at or near 78 deg F. We will follow the USAT rules on water temperatures and wetsuit usage.

It is important to practice in open water before this or any event with the equipment you plan to race in (wetsuit, goggles etc).
Open water swim starts can be a bit intimidating. If this is your first open water event simply start toward the back of your wave and take it slow and let the crowds go, it is normal for first timers to experience a little panic in the first part of the swim, but just keep swimming! :)
At any time before the race if you don't feel confidant in your ability to complete the swim you can transfer to the duathlon event without penalty.
Only you the athlete know if you are prepared to complete this event, if there is any doubt please don't compete.
There is inherit risk in open water swimming such as cramps, panic attacks, stroke, heart attack, heart arrhythmia, physical injury from other swimmers, water obstacles, etc - that could result in serious injury or death. Swimming is at your own risk.
